How Long Does a Siren Sound on an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5?
The siren on a Simon XTi or XTi-5 System will continue to sound until the siren timeout period expires. This can be set from anywhere between 2 minutes and 254 minutes. It can also be turned off to have the siren sound indefinitely. Learn how to adjust the Simon XTi and XTi-5 siren timeout.

Can I Connect to the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5 w/ an iPad?
An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5 System can be controlled by an iPad through the Alarm.com Mobile App. This app can be downloaded for free from the Apple App Store. The system will need active cellular service to sync with Alarm.com. Learn how to use an iPad with a Simon XTi or XTi-5.

Which Deadbolt Lock Is Compatible w/ an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5?
The Simon XTi and XTi-5 Systems are capable of supporting almost any Z-Wave lock once a Z-Wave Controller has been added. The lock is paired with the system and included into the Z-Wave network. It can then be controlled using the Alarm.com service. Learn more about using Z-Wave door locks.

How Do I Activate the Chime on an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5?
The chime is activated on an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5 Alarm System by faulting a sensor with an appropriate sensor group while the system is disarmed. The chime for the panel must be enabled when doing this. Learn more about the chime function on a Simon XTi or XTi-5 Alarm System.

How Do I Get Power to an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5?
An Interlogix XTi or XTi-5 receives its power from an 18-gauge 2-conductor wire. The wire connects the system and its plug-in 9-volt AC transformer. A Honeywell LT-Cable can also be used to make the wiring process somewhat easier. Learn more about powering an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5.

Does an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5 Support Partitions?
The Interlogix Simon XTi and XTi-5 Panels are single-partition alarm systems. They do not provide support for multiple partitions. If a user wants to use multiple partitions, they will need to upgrade to a different type of alarm system. Learn more about partitioning on an alarm system.

How Do I Add Additional User Codes to an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5?
The option for adding new user codes to an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5 is found through system programming. The system's current Master Code is required to access this menu. Up to eight standard user codes can be added to the system. Learn more about user codes on the XTi and XTi-5.

Can I Use an Interlogix Simon XTi or XTi-5 w/o Monitoring?
Although the Interlogix Simon XTi and XTi-5 Systems can certainly be used without monitoring, this will severely limit their functionality. They will have no way of reporting out to the user, and using remote interactive services will be impossible. Learn more about the Simon XTi and XTi-5.

Can I Use an LT-Cable w/ an Interlogix Simon XT Alarm System?
Using a Honeywell LT-Cable can make it easier to get power to a Simon XT System. The cable will eliminate the need to strip any wires, and it will work just as effectively as a traditional 18-gauge 2-conductor wire. Learn more about wiring an Interlogix Simon XT using a Honeywell LT-Cable.
